Some stuff from this past weekend. Alignment and corner balance this upcoming week. Going to pick up the alignment to 2.3 F and 2.8 R. Since the new suspension was installed the specs are off, although the coilovers were measured to the T. Previously the car was at 3.1 in the rear and 2.5 in the front. I assume it is around there in these pictures. Additional maintenance and goodies to come before the start of the season!

anyone run WedsSports SA25R's on their S2000. Still deciding between the following options

option A - SA25R 18x7+53 / 8.5+50
option B - TC105X 17x8+42 / 9+49
option C - TC105X 17x8+42 / 9+35(machine the wheel hub to get more clearance and keep the aggressive MR face look)

I had a Berlina red interior before and had work wheels Emotion CR Kai's 17x8+47/9+38 and had the rears machined and it worked out well.

I'd like to have a similar look this time with my new berlina red interior but with WedsSports wheels
